Simpson Barracks Upgrade

Project: Simpson Barracks Upgrade (Defence Force School of Signals Redevelopment)
Principal Contractor: ACE Contractors
The Simpson Barracks Upgrade is a Department of Defence project delivering a new two-storey building for the Defence Force School of Signals at Simpson Barracks, Yallambie. ACE Contractors is engaged to deliver the civil scope of works for the redevelopment, supporting the base’s ongoing role as home to the Defence Force School of Signals, the Financial Services Unit, the Defence Force School of Music and the headquarters of 4th Brigade. The civil works underpin the new facility’s structure and services, including earthworks, pavements and stormwater infrastructure required ahead of the building’s construction. Key aspects of the project include:
- Earthworks, pavements and footpaths for the new Defence Force School of Signals building
- Stormwater drainage system and an onsite detention tank
- Footings for retaining walls and a new electrical substation
- Landscaping works across the redevelopment site
HCS is engaged on the project to provide Underground Service Locating and Ground Penetration Officer services.
